Executive search: then and now
From confidential rolodexes to AI-assisted leadership mapping, executive search has been quietly transformed.
The retainer model is intact, but everything around it has changed. Confidentiality is preserved by encrypted channels, not closed doors. Mapping is half human, half model-assisted. Reference-checks are now stress-tested with structured anonymous panels.
Yet the heart of the work is unchanged: judgment, discretion, and the ability to tell a candidate things their team cannot.
